Output 23341537752eec2513b4741ae1088a08984ff660e764215fdda3aa5297c4ac1b:9

value
58020000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cef34df36beafacc1fc60318ce0b43b81bb251fd OP_EQUALVERIFY OP_CHECKSIG
address
1KsFfcNKKA6tj7A7KKDcZ3ZnJQnPjPMrBD
transaction
23341537752eec2513b4741ae1088a08984ff660e764215fdda3aa5297c4ac1b
spent
true